Course Overview


Personal drug and alcohol use can influence workplace performance. This safety training explores drug and alcohol use disorders in office environments for employees.

This course starts by exploring the differences between stimulants and depressants. This course also explores how people develop substance abuse disorders. This training discusses how organizations might support employee recovery from substance use disorders.

Substance abuse can cause accidents and mistakes that impact all employees. Use this training to educate office environment employees about drug and alcohol use disorders.
